dsl 相关问题

特定于域的语言是一种用于特定应用程序域的编程语言

Apache Camel-从yaml属性中使用uri移动文件

我正在尝试使用Apache Camel处理文件,并在处理后将其移动到特定文件夹,同时保留文件名和目录结构。我在application.yml文件中拥有的内容:camel -...

回答 1 投票 1

DSL:在特定类型的集合的每个元素上应用功能的快捷方式

我是scala的新手,我正在尝试使用其强大的功能来创建简单的DSL。我发现使用DSL时可以创建类似于以下示例的内容,我想知道它是如何...

回答 1 投票 0

表达和定义逻辑

我正在尝试为GUI工具表达某种逻辑,以使诊断更加容易。在起点处,总是会问相同的问题(问题A)。取决于问题的答案...

回答 1 投票 0

Xtext验证程序-检查所有X元素以进行元素Y验证

我在这里试图找出是否有人在我的语法中知道如何做一个验证器,该验证器检查我的步骤是否仅使用我之前在'成分+ =成分+'中声明的成分。

回答 1 投票 0

找到javax.mail.AuthenticationFailedException:连接失败,未指定密码?在收听密码正确的新邮件时

此异常是我在使用Spring集成连接imap gmail存储时遇到的。请查看代码{@Autowired private IntegrationFlowContext flowContext;公共无效...

回答 1 投票 0

使用dsl,dslr在Drools中检查列表中的特定元素

我刚刚开始使用Drools Workbench 6.5.0,我有两个类Client {字符串名称;琴弦时代列表 产品; }类Product {字符串代码;字符串...

回答 1 投票 1

如何使用NEST构造记录的汇总(计数)?

我有如下要求,要使用NEST包装器执行记录的聚合(计数),但要在NEST内部触发DSL查询。由于,我不知道如何正确地构造它,所以我做了...

回答 1 投票 0

是否可以导出由JetBrains MPS创建的DSL编译器并独立使用(例如,从另一个Java程序调用它)

我想构建一个DSL并按如下方式使用它:DSL编译为Java。导出DSL编译器并将其打包(即作为JAR打包),因此我可以从Java应用程序调用DSL编译器来编译“ ...

回答 1 投票 0

Kotlin接收器功能用于DSL所需的解释

[我正在尝试理解以下代码(来自https://kotlinlang.org/docs/reference/lambdas.html)类HTML {fun body(){...}} fun html(init:HTML。( )->单位):HTML {val html = ...

回答 2 投票 1

用于DSL的嵌入式脚本引擎

我正在研究一个需要嵌入式DSL来满足其预期要求的项目。 DSL将基于用户定义的事件。这里是所需语法的模型:user-defined-event-1 {...

回答 8 投票 3

弹性搜索不得使子句无法正常工作

我在使用“ must_not”子句在弹性搜索中过滤我的搜索查询时遇到了一些问题,我为索引插入的映射{“” monojit“:{” mappings“:{” banik“:{...

回答 1 投票 0

带有IN表达式的Couchbase Java N1QL DSL查询语句

[试图从WHERE s IN [“ s1”,“ s2”,...,“ sn”的存储桶中编写类似SELECT *的N1QL查询] END;在DSL中。假设我有一个名为s_array的字符串列表,我需要编写如下内容:select(...

回答 1 投票 1

Drools DSL解析器日志记录

Drools DSL解析器失败,出现与drl语法有关的错误,该语法缺少有关DSL本身的信息。可能很难猜测DSL的哪些部分已成功解析,并且确切的和平是...

回答 1 投票 0

如何将DSL语法转换为脚本语法

下面是groovy DSL中的代码段:插件{id(“ com.github.johnrengelman.shadow”)版本“ 5.2.0”},如果下面是相应的脚本语法,我很难理解:.. 。

回答 2 投票 0

build.gradle-找不到方法copyDeps()作为参数

下面是build.gradle文件:plugins({id('application')id'java'id('com.github.johnrengelman.shadow')。version('4.0.1')})allprojects({ (插件:“应用程序”)apply(...

回答 1 投票 0

Gradle-如何将DSL语法转换为脚本语法?

[下面是Groovy DSL中的build.gradle,我希望将其转换为脚本语法:插件{id'application'id'java'id'com.github.johnrengelman.shadow'版本'4.0.1'} allprojects { ...

回答 1 投票 0

drosl DSL将表达式添加到带有'-'的最后一个模式不起作用

我一直在使用Drools规则,并且最近才开始使用dsl,以使最终用户更容易编写规则。虽然我已经能够定义并正确地设置一个简单的dsl ...

回答 1 投票 0

如何使用Antlr4停用令牌

我必须用antlr4解析一个由许多数据块组成的文本文件,每个数据块都有一个数据块标题(一行)和数个DataRows(1 .. *)行。数据块标题总是以'1'......]开头

回答 1 投票 1

如何在dslr规则中使用not()?

我想表达类似规则“ R”的规则,当a:A()c:C(a.timestamp ] >>

回答 1 投票 1

使用Groovy DSL委托getter覆盖现有属性

在下面的示例中,我想用我自己的委托人的逻辑覆盖所有属性。但是我只能对不存在的属性执行此操作,在编译时已知的属性保持不变。是...

回答 1 投票 1

© www.soinside.com 2019 - 2024. All rights reserved.